High hat Drum fish
 
Is a Hi-hat Drum fish reef safe? I picked one up at the FMAS auction last night and they told me it was.

NanoKat 08/29/2008 09:12 AM

Sounds like they're reef safe, but do feed on inverts...so some small shrimp and whatnot might get eaten in your tank...
